India’sfirst private semiconductor manufacturing facility is set to be established inAndhra Pradesh with a massive investment of Rs 14,000 crore. This landmarkproject, aimed at boosting India's semiconductor production capabilities, willplay a crucial role in reducing the country’s dependence on imports andstrengthening its position in the global tech supply chain.
Thestate-of-the-art facility will be developed in collaboration with leadingplayers in the semiconductor industry, marking a significant step forward inIndia’s pursuit of becoming a global hub for advanced technology manufacturing.The project is expected to create thousands of jobs in the region and offerimmense potential for skill development in the high-tech sector.
Thesemiconductor plant will focus on producing chips for various applications,including consumer electronics, telecommunications, automotive, and industrialuses. This will help meet the growing demand for semiconductors, which arecritical components for modern technology.
TheAndhra Pradesh government has been instrumental in attracting this investment,offering attractive incentives to companies involved in the project. Theinitiative is expected to bolster the state’s economy, attracting furtherinvestments in technology and innovation.
Theestablishment of this facility aligns with India’s broader push forself-reliance in the semiconductor sector, which has become increasinglyimportant due to global supply chain disruptions. With the growing demand forsemiconductors worldwide, this development promises to place India at theforefront of semiconductor manufacturing in the coming years.
Officialshave highlighted that the facility will not only help in meeting domesticdemand but will also provide India with a competitive edge in the globalsemiconductor market.
